626 L4-1998 cc 2.0L SOHC Turbo FE (1986)
Evaporator Core: Customer Interest
A/C Evaporator - Low Air Flow from Vents, Poor Cooling
Category 16
Applicable Model/s 1986-87 626
Subject A/C FREEZE-UP
Bulletin No.
045/89
Issued
12/29/89
Revised
DESCRIPTION
When a customer complains of the following items, the vehicle is probably experiencing A/C evaporator icing or freeze up.
1.
Decrease in air flow from the A/C vents after a short period of time.
2.
A/C cools well only for the first few minutes of operation. (Depending on the weather condition, it may take 30-60 minutes to freeze up.)
To confirm a customer complaint, dealers are requested to make sure that the compressor does not cycle after a short period of time.
To correct this, the thermistor probe should be replaced with the thermostat.
NOTE:
If the compressor does cycle and there is insufficient cooling, the heater mixture door could be partially open. Check and adjust it in accordance with
Service Bulletin Category 16, 022/87.
